SeahawksCharles Cross Undergoes Finger Surgery, Expected to Return by Season Opener

Seattle’s coaches are using training camp to evaluate left tackle options as Cross rehabs in Mike Macdonald’s system.

Overview

  • Cross underwent successful surgery to repair a dislocated finger and is expected to be ready for the regular-season opener on September 7.
  • He had practiced through the injury before opting for the procedure during the preseason window.
  • Swing tackle Josh Jones has taken first-team reps while McClendon Curtis and undrafted rookie Michael Jerrell compete for left tackle opportunities.
  • Cross’s temporary absence coincides with the installation of Mike Macdonald and Ryan Grubb’s new offensive scheme.
  • A 2022 first-round pick, Cross started all 17 games in 2024 and has his fifth-year contract option secured as the line’s anchor.
